Optimizing Municipal Solid Waste Collection

Waste generation continues to be a major concern for municipalities worldwide. Adopting efficient waste collection systems is crucial for curtailing the environmental impact and ensuring public health. Approaches for optimization can include employing advanced technologies such as smart sensors, efficient routing algorithms, and robotic collection systems.

Moreover, encouraging public participation through education and awareness campaigns on waste segregation plus recycling can substantially enhance the effectiveness of municipal solid waste collection programs.

Advanced Technologies for Waste Management

Waste management deals a growing problem as global populations grow. Fortunately, advanced technologies are emerging to improve the way we handle of waste. These technologies present a wide range of solutions, from automation to composting.

One effective area is connected waste systems that detect fill levels and enhance collection routes. ,Furthermore, sophisticated sorting equipment can classify different types of waste with greater effectiveness, leading to higher recycling rates.

Another important advancement is the creation of compostable materials that can disintegrate naturally, reducing the amount of waste that ends up in landfills.

Furthermore, technologies like waste-to-energy are being adopted to convert waste into renewable energy, creating a more circular economy.

With embracing these cutting-edge technologies, we can build a more environmentally friendly future for waste management.
